在当今互联网时代,网站是企业或个人展示信息、提供服务的重要平台。因此,拥有一个高效且专业的网站建设团队至关重要。作为网站建设团队的一员,每个成员都承担着特定的职责,共同推动项目的顺利进行。本文将详细介绍网站建设岗位的主要职责。
一、需求分析与规划
1.1 需求调研
- 职责描述:与客户沟通,了解项目背景、目标受众、业务需求等。
- 关键技能:良好的沟通能力、市场敏感度、用户研究能力。
1.2 制定方案
- 职责描述:根据调研结果,制定符合客户需求的网站设计方案,包括但不限于页面布局、功能设计、技术选型等。
- 关键技能:创新思维、用户体验设计、技术知识。
二、前端开发
2.1 页面设计与实现
- 职责描述:使用HTML、CSS和JavaScript等技术,按照设计稿实现网页页面。
- 关键技能:熟练掌握前端框架(如React、Vue等)、响应式设计、交互设计。
2.2 前端优化
- 职责描述:对前端代码进行性能优化,提升用户体验,提高加载速度。
- 关键技能:代码优化技巧、浏览器兼容性处理、SEO优化知识。
三、后端开发
3.1 数据库设计
- 职责描述:根据项目需求,设计数据库结构,优化查询效率。
- 关键技能:SQL编程、NoSQL数据库知识、数据安全意识。
3.2 后端逻辑实现
- 职责描述:使用服务器端语言(如Java、Python、PHP等)编写业务逻辑代码。
- 关键技能:编程基础扎实、算法与数据结构、系统架构设计。
四、全栈开发
4.1 技术选型
- 职责描述:根据项目需求,选择合适的前后端技术栈。
- 关键技能:跨领域技术整合能力、快速学习新技能的能力。
4.2 开发与调试
- 职责描述:负责整个开发过程,包括编码、测试、调试等。
- 关键技能:问题解决能力、持续集成与持续部署(CI/CD)知识。
五、测试与上线
5.1 单元测试
- 职责描述:对单个模块进行单元测试,确保代码质量。
- 关键技能:自动化测试工具使用、代码覆盖率分析。
5.2 集成测试
- 职责描述:测试各个模块之间的集成情况,确保系统稳定运行。
- 关键技能:系统测试方法、性能测试知识。
5.3 上线准备
- 职责描述:准备上线前的各项任务,包括文档编写、备份、培训等。
- 关键技能:项目管理经验、风险控制意识。
六、维护与优化
6.1 系统监控
- 职责描述:实时监控系统状态,及时发现并解决问题。
- 关键技能:日志分析、故障排除能力。
6.2 用户反馈处理
- 职责描述:收集用户反馈,持续优化网站功能和用户体验。
- 关键技能:数据分析能力、用户心理理解。
6.3 定期更新
- 职责描述:定期对网站进行功能更新和安全补丁安装。
- 关键技能:版本控制系统使用、安全防护知识。
通过以上职责的分工,一个高效的网站建设团队能够确保项目的高质量完成,满足不同客户的需求。如果你正在寻找一个适合你的角色,或者想要加入这个充满挑战和机遇的行业,请随时关注我们。
如没特殊注明,文章均为星之河原创,转载请注明来自https://www.00448.cn/news/24190.html